About Fiona McKean

Darren and I are both passionate about photography however both concentrate on very different area's. I specialise in Wedding and Portrait Photography and relish the pleasure of recording in a timeless way those moments in your life that will be more valuable to you in years to come than they often are today. While Darren often assists me on a wedding shoot he tends to concentrate on commercial & food photography, he assures me this has nothing to do with the fact he loves getting to try the produce he has just photographed! The thing we both have in common is the passion to record these moments so that you can look over then time and again.
